Applications for a senior affordable housing unit lottery in Honolulu are now open.
Kokua Hale will be in Honolulu, on 1192 Alakea Street, and include 222 studio units, with monthly rents beginning at $687.
Starting at 12:01 a.m. Thursday, June 1, 2023, union workers with Hawaii Gas Company will go on strike.
Members of Teamsters Local 996 say the management from Hawaii Gas refuses to negotiate on benefits like retirement, medical, and living wages.

The Honolulu Zoo welcomed new addition Enzi, an adult male lion, all the way from Indiana.
He is eight years old and was born on September 21, 2015 in Indianapolis.
A second suspect in a deadly Makaha shooting has been charged, HPD reports.
20-year-old Waylen Armstrong-Ke'a was charged with second degree murder, first degree arson, and firearm offenses relating to the Sunday, May 21 incident at Makaha Beach park.
